Study on the Stability of Herbal Medicine for Iontophoresis





Abstract
Iontophoresis is a simple, well-documented method of drug application for medication of tissues. It is possible to medicate electrically any surface tissue with drugs having a positive or negative charge. The technique involves transporting selected ions electrically into a tissue by passing a direct electrical current through a medication solution and the patient, using selected electrode polarity. I am interested in applying herbal medicine to a new method of treatment in musculoskeletal inflammatory conditions instead of western medicine. It is necessary to study on the stability of herbal medicine before application of iontophoresis clinically. Corydalis Tuber, Carthami Flos, and Cnidii Rhizoma were selected and studied. The results are as follows.
1. There were no significant changes in the UV spectrum pattern of these herbal medicines.
2. In the electrical conductivity measurement, the conductivity of Corydalis Tuber ranged from 18.00 to .18.57 , that of Carthami Flos ranged from 17.58 to 18.28, and that of Cnidii Rhizoma ranged from 18.15 to 18.94 .
"There were no significant changes in the electrical conductivity in connection with the UV spectrum measurement.
3. In the pH measurement, the pH of all the herbal medicines was- measured between 7.06 and 7.07 in the begining, and ranged from 6.909 to 7.601. There were no significant changes in the pH in connection with the UV spectrum measurement.
4. In the quantitative analysis of ions, there were much more anions than cations in Corydalis Tuber.
5. In Carthami Flos and Cnidii Rhizoma, more anions were distributed than cations.
6. More anions distributed mainly within all the herbal medicines were Cl-,SO42- and metals were K, Na .
7. In the HPLC chromatogram, comparing herbal medicines in cold storage with herbal medicines at room temperature, there were no significant changes.
Based on these results, it shows that experemental herbal medicines have stability in the study.
